FTPie vs Gyazo

Instant capture links either way - the difference is whose servers your images live on.

FTPie - Capture & share from storage you own vs Gyazo - Hosted screenshot & capture service

Gyazo nailed the instant-capture experience: grab a region, and a link to the image is on your clipboard a second later. It is fast and frictionless, which is exactly why people love it. The same model powers Zight (formerly CloudApp), Droplr and similar tools.

The trade-off is custody and cost. With Gyazo, your captures live on Gyazo's servers, and the genuinely useful parts - history, search, longer retention - sit behind a subscription. FTPie offers the same one-second capture-to-link flow, but the link points at a cloud account you own, for a one-time price.

Where Gyazo has the edge

Gyazo is honestly very good at its one thing. Its capture-to-link flow is instant, it works across Windows and Mac, and its hosted nature means a recipient just clicks a link - no thinking about where the file lives. The paid tiers add a searchable history, GIF capture and longer retention. If you want a zero-setup hosted service and do not mind the subscription, Gyazo is a fine choice.

Where FTPie has the edge

FTPie's screenshot tool captures and annotates, then Quick Share returns a link from a cloud account you control. Because the file lives on your storage, you keep it, you can delete it, and there is no third party retaining your captures or expiring them when a plan lapses. And it is one feature of a full file manager - the same app handles your cloud, FTP, backups and transfers - for a one-time price rather than a recurring fee.

So which should you pick?

If you want the simplest possible hosted capture service, with a searchable history and nothing to manage, Gyazo (or Zight/Droplr) is purpose-built for that. Pick it if hosted convenience matters more than ownership.

If you would rather your captures live on storage you control, pay once instead of monthly, and have screenshots and recordings inside the same app you use for your cloud and FTP files, FTPie is the better fit. As a Gyazo alternative it puts ownership and a one-time price first.
